Abstract
- Chicken egg white ovotransferrin (OTF) has been reported to exist in three electrophoretic variants (OTF <superscript>A</superscript> , OTF <superscript>B</superscript> and OTF <superscript>C</superscript> ). In this report, we identified a causal polymorphism between the OTF <superscript>B</superscript> and OTF <superscript>C</superscript> variants in Japanese and Taiwanese native chickens and compared the antibacterial activity between these two variants. The cDNA sequence analyses from Satsumadori oviducts revealed that three non-synonymous SNPs T1809G (Ser52Ala), A2258G (Ile96Val) and G7823A (Asp500Asn) corresponded to the OTF electrophoretic phenotypes. Of the three SNPs, the G7823A mutation perfectly corresponded to the electrophoretic phenotypes OTF <superscript>B</superscript> (G/G, Asp500Asp), OTF <superscript>B/C</superscript> (G/A, Asp500Asn) and OTF <superscript>C</superscript> (A/A, Asn500Asn) in three chicken populations. The variants OTF <superscript>B</superscript> and OTF <superscript>C</superscript> exhibited similar antibacterial potency against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ria. This study provides, for the first time, molecular information on polymorphism of OTF <superscript>B</superscript> and OTF <superscript>C</superscript> variants of chicken ovotransferrin and its effect on the antimicrobial activity of the respective variants.<br /> (2016, Japan Poultry Science Association.)
